The Evolution of Hypnosis Training

Hypnosis, often depicted in pop culture as a mysterious and mystical art, has its roots deeply embedded in psychology and neuroscience. Initially utilized for entertainment purposes, hypnosis gradually gained recognition as a legitimate therapeutic technique for addressing various issues, including stress reduction, smoking cessation, weight loss, and phobia management.

Traditionally, individuals interested in mastering the art of hypnosis sought out in-person training sessions conducted by experienced practitioners. While these face-to-face interactions undoubtedly hold value, they may not always be feasible due to geographical constraints or scheduling conflicts. Recognizing the need for accessible alternatives, the field of hypnotherapy has embraced online platforms, ushering in a new era of learning and exploration.

The Advantages of Online Hypnosis Training

Online hypnosis training offers a plethora of advantages that cater to the modern lifestyle:

  1. Accessibility: Perhaps the most significant benefit of online training is its accessibility. Learners from all corners of the globe can participate in courses without being bound by geographical limitations. This opens up opportunities for individuals residing in remote areas or those with mobility constraints to pursue their interest in hypnosis.

  2. Flexibility: Online courses provide flexibility in terms of scheduling. Learners can access course materials and participate in sessions at their convenience, fitting learning around their existing commitments and responsibilities.

  3. Variety of Resources: Online platforms offer a diverse range of resources, including instructional videos, written materials, interactive exercises, and live webinars. This multifaceted approach caters to different learning styles, ensuring that participants can engage with the content in a manner that resonates with them.
